Sonova’s principles 

Sustainable thinking and action are an integral part of the Sonova Group’s daily operational business and a key factor in its long-term success. Improving the quality of life of people with hearing loss is at the heart of Sonova’s activities. With this in mind, the Group is committed to continuously refining and optimizing its hearing healthcare solutions worldwide. Whether a person’s hearing loss is mild or profound, Sonova provides hearing solutions to suit all needs and thus makes a valuable contribution to society.

 

Responsibility for sustainability issues and the further development thereof is vested at Group management level. The Group Vice President Corporate Human Resources is responsible for sustainability management in the areas of employee and social matters. The Group Vice President Operations looks after aspects concerning energy, the environment and suppliers. Sustainable customer relationships are the responsibility of the Group Vice President Marketing, and Compliance Management and Corporate Governance fall within the remit of the Chief Financial Officer.

 

In its dealings with employees, customers, suppliers, business partners and shareholders, the company follows generally recognized ethical principles. 

 

Sonova’s vision
Sonova aims to improve the quality of life for those with hearing loss – whether infants, children or adults – and enable them to hear, understand and learn better.

 

Sonova’s mission

Sonova realizes its vision through continuous development of new hearing healthcare solutions. The Group offers state-of-the-art products and services for virtually every type and degree of hearing loss and brings together the most innovative brands in the field of hearing systems.

 

Sonova’s values
People – both customers and employees – are the focus of all of Sonova’s activities. The Sonova Group is involved in numerous projects and initiatives aimed at raising general awareness of good hearing and the benefits of hearing systems. Sonova aims to be the employer of choice and focuses on flat hierarchical structures and open communication – as a basis for long-term decisions and rapid results. Through efficient and responsible use of resources, Sonova creates a solid basis for sustainable and environmentally-friendly business practices.
